excel中row 什么意思
作者:路由通
|
131人看过
发布时间:2025-11-06 02:43:39
标签:
在电子表格软件中,行(ROW)是一个基础而强大的概念,它不仅代表工作表中的横向单元格序列,更通过行函数(ROW)实现动态数据定位。本文将深入解析行的双重含义,涵盖从基础操作到高级应用的12个核心场景,包括函数嵌套、数组公式、与索引(INDEX)等函数的协同使用,通过实际案例展示如何利用行特性提升数据处理效率。
在电子表格软件的使用过程中,行(ROW)这个概念看似简单,却蕴含着丰富的数据处理逻辑。无论是刚接触表格的新手还是资深用户,准确理解行的含义及其相关功能,都能显著提升工作效率。本文将系统性地剖析行的双重身份——既作为表格的基本结构单元,也作为一项强大的函数工具,并通过具体场景展示其实际应用价值。
行的基础概念解析 在表格界面中,行指的是水平方向排列的单元格序列,每行通过左侧的数字进行标识。例如,工作表中从上到下的数字1、2、3等就是行号。这种结构化的排列方式构成了数据存储的基础框架。与之对应的是列(COLUMN),即垂直方向的单元格序列,通过顶部的字母标识。行列交叉形成的网格,为数据组织提供了直观的载体。 案例一:在制作员工信息表时,可以将每位员工的资料单独存放在一行中。例如,第一行存放张三的工号、姓名、部门,第二行存放李四的对应信息。这种一行对应一条记录的方式,符合数据管理的常规逻辑。 案例二:当需要对特定行进行操作时,用户可以直接点击行号选中整行,进行格式设置、插入或删除等操作。例如,选中第5行后右键选择“插入”,即可在该行上方新增一个空白行,用于补充数据。 行函数的基本语法与返回值 行函数(ROW)的作用是返回指定单元格的行号。其语法格式非常简单:行函数(ROW)或行函数(ROW(参考位置))。当参数留空时,函数返回公式所在单元格的行号;当参数指定某个单元格地址时,则返回该单元格的行号。 案例一:在单元格输入“=行函数(ROW())”,假设公式位于第8行,则计算结果为8。这个特性常用于需要动态获取当前行号的场景。 案例二:输入“=行函数(ROW(B15))”,无论公式位于何处,都会返回15,因为单元格地址对应第15行。这种方法适用于需要绝对引用特定行号的场景。 创建动态序列号的核心技巧 传统的序列号输入方式在增删行后容易失效,而行函数(ROW)可以构建自动更新的序号系统。基本原理是利用当前行号与起始行号的差值生成连续序号。 案例一:在数据区域的首个单元格输入“=行函数(ROW())-行函数(ROW($A$1))”,向下填充。公式通过当前行号减去标题行的固定行号,生成从1开始的连续序号。当中间插入新行时,序号会自动重新计算保持连续。 案例二:如需序号从特定数字开始,可修改为“=行函数(ROW())-行函数(ROW($A$1))+10”,这样序号会从11开始递增。这种方法特别适用于需要预留前序编号的数据表。 与索引函数协同实现动态查询 行函数(ROW)与索引函数(INDEX)的组合是动态数据提取的经典方案。索引函数(INDEX)负责根据位置返回数据,而行函数(ROW)则提供动态变化的位置参数。 案例一:从产品列表中提取特定间隔的记录。公式“=索引函数(INDEX($A$2:$A$100,行函数(ROW())3-2))”会每3行提取一个产品名称,生成浓缩的摘要列表。 案例二:构建可扩展的交叉查询表。通过将行函数(ROW)作为索引函数(INDEX)的行参数,配合条件判断,可以创建随数据源自动扩展的查询结果区域,避免手动调整引用范围。 在条件格式中的动态范围控制 行函数(ROW)在条件格式中能够实现基于行位置的动态格式化效果。通过判断当前行号与特定条件的关系,自动应用格式规则。 案例一:隔行着色增强可读性。选择数据区域后,创建条件格式规则,公式为“=取余函数(MOD(行函数(ROW()),2)=0”,设置填充颜色。这样偶数行会自动着色,形成明显的视觉区分。 案例二:高亮显示特定范围的行。例如,只需标记行号50到100之间的数据行,可以使用“=且函数(AND(行函数(ROW())>=50,行函数(ROW())<=100))”作为条件格式公式,实现精准的视觉聚焦。 构建复杂数组公式的基石作用 在数组公式中,行函数(ROW)常与间接函数(INDIRECT)等配合,生成动态的序列数组,为复杂计算提供支持。这种用法在高级数据分析中尤为常见。 案例一:提取不连续间隔的数据。公式“=大括号(索引函数(INDEX(数据区域,小括号(()行函数(ROW(间接函数(INDIRECT("1:"&计数函数(COUNTA(数据区域)))))))))”可以生成一个动态数组,灵活处理非连续数据块。 案例二:解决排序函数(SORT)等动态数组函数的兼容性问题。在旧版本中,可以通过行函数(ROW)构建辅助序列,模拟现代版本中的动态数组功能,实现数据的自动溢出填充。 数据验证中的动态列表生成 行函数(ROW)可以帮助创建动态的下拉列表,使数据验证范围随数据增减自动调整。这种方法比静态引用更加灵活可靠。 案例一:创建排除标题行的动态列表。在数据验证的来源中输入“=偏移函数(OFFSET($A$2,0,0,计数函数(COUNTA($A:$A)-1,1))”,结合计数函数(COUNTA)统计非空行数,确保新添加的数据自动纳入下拉选项。 案例二:多条件动态列表。通过行函数(ROW)配合索引函数(INDEX)和条件判断,可以创建基于其他单元格值变化的二级下拉菜单,提升数据输入的准确性和效率。 与间接函数结合实现灵活引用 间接函数(INDIRECT)可以将文本字符串转换为实际引用,而行函数(ROW)提供动态的行号参数,二者结合可以实现高度灵活的单元格引用。 案例一:动态求和最近N行的数据。公式“=求和函数(SUM(间接函数(INDIRECT("A"&行函数(ROW())-9&":A"&行函数(ROW()))))”会自动计算当前行及前9行数据的合计值,随公式位置变化自动调整范围。 案例二:跨表动态引用。通过构建“表名!A”连接行函数(ROW())的文本字符串,再用间接函数(INDIRECT)转换,可以实现随着行号变化自动引用不同工作表的对应位置。 在查找函数中的精确定位应用 行函数(ROW)可以与查找函数(VLOOKUP)或索引函数(INDEX)匹配函数(MATCH)组合,解决复杂查找问题,特别是需要返回多个相关值的场景。 案例一:查找返回整行数据。传统查找函数(VLOOKUP)只能返回单列值,结合行函数(ROW)和索引函数(INDEX)可以构建公式,根据查找值返回对应行的所有列数据。 案例二:双向查找的简化实现。通过将行函数(ROW)作为匹配函数(MATCH)的行查找参数,可以快速定位数据在矩阵中的精确位置,实现行列交叉点的数值提取。 行与列函数的协同效应 行函数(ROW)与列函数(COLUMN)经常配对使用,在处理二维数据时发挥协同作用。这种组合在矩阵运算和交叉分析中尤为有效。 案例一:快速填充乘法表。在单元格输入“=行函数(ROW(A1))列函数(COLUMN(A1))”,向右向下填充,即可自动生成完整的乘法表,行列号相乘得出结果。 案例二:动态二维数据提取。通过行函数(ROW)控制行偏移量,列函数(COLUMN)控制列偏移量,配合偏移函数(OFFSET)可以从大型数据表中提取指定大小的动态子集。 错误处理与公式稳健性提升 在使用行函数(ROW)的动态公式中,必须考虑可能出现的错误情况,通过错误处理函数提升公式的稳健性,避免数据变动导致的公式失效。 案例一:防止超出范围的错误。在索引函数(INDEX)公式外层嵌套如果错误函数(IFERROR),当行函数(ROW)返回的值超出数据范围时,显示友好提示而非错误值。 案例二:处理空行的智能判断。结合条件函数如如果函数(IF)和空白判断函数(ISBLANK),可以在行函数(ROW)定位到空行时自动跳过,避免不必要的计算或显示。 性能优化与计算效率考量 在大数据量工作表中,不当使用行函数(ROW)可能引发性能问题。理解计算原理并优化公式写法,可以显著提升运算速度。 案例一:避免整列引用。使用“行函数(ROW($A$1:$A$1000))”代替“行函数(ROW($A:$A))”,限制引用范围,减少不必要的计算负荷。 案例二:使用现代动态数组函数替代传统数组公式。在支持动态数组的版本中,优先使用序列函数(SEQUENCE)等专门函数,比基于行函数(ROW)的复杂数组公式效率更高。 实际业务场景的综合应用 行函数(ROW)的价值最终体现在解决实际业务问题上。通过综合运用前述技巧,可以构建强大而灵活的自动化解决方案。 案例一:自动化报表生成系统。结合行函数(ROW)的动态行号、条件格式和数据验证,创建能够随源数据自动调整格式和内容的智能报表模板。 案例二:动态图表数据源。使用行函数(ROW)构建的动态命名范围作为图表数据源,当添加新数据时,图表自动扩展显示范围,无需手动调整数据源引用。 版本差异与兼容性注意事项 不同版本的电子表格软件对行相关功能的支持存在差异,了解这些差异有助于编写兼容性更好的公式,确保在不同环境中正常工作。 案例一:动态数组功能的版本差异。现代版本中新增的序列函数(SEQUENCE)可以替代部分行函数(ROW)的复杂用法,但在旧版本中仍需使用行函数(ROW)构建解决方案。 案例二:函数计算引擎的优化。新版本对数组公式的计算效率有显著提升,相同的行函数(ROW)数组公式在新环境中运行速度更快,这在设计大型模型时需要考量。 通过以上多个角度的探讨,我们可以看到行在电子表格中远不止是简单的网格线标识。从基础结构到函数应用,从简单操作到复杂系统构建,行相关功能贯穿了数据处理的各个环节。掌握这些技巧不仅能够提升日常工作效率,更能为解决复杂业务问题提供有力工具。随着对行特性理解的深入,用户将能够更加自如地驾驭电子表格软件,发掘数据管理的更多可能性。
相关文章
电子表格软件中部分行被隐藏的现象背后存在多重技术因素和实用场景。本文通过系统分析十二个关键维度,涵盖从基础误操作到高级数据管理的完整知识图谱,结合企业财务报告制作、学术数据处理等典型场景案例,深入解析隐藏行功能的实际应用价值。文章还将提供包括快捷键组合、定位工具使用在内的完整解决方案,帮助用户全面提升电子表格数据处理能力。
2025-11-06 02:43:27
90人看过
在日常办公中,将Word文档转换为PDF格式时常常遇到各种问题,导致转换失败或效果不佳。本文将深入剖析十二个核心原因,包括字体嵌入限制、图片兼容性问题、文档结构复杂性等。通过具体案例和基于官方文档的解决方案,帮助用户系统性地排查和解决转换过程中的常见故障,提升文档处理效率。
2025-11-06 02:41:58
147人看过
本文详细解析文档处理软件中背景色的核心概念与实用技巧。从基础定义到高级应用,涵盖12个重点维度,包含官方操作指南和实际案例演示,帮助用户掌握背景设置、颜色搭配、打印处理等全流程技能,提升文档专业性和视觉表现力。
2025-11-06 02:41:54
345人看过
在移动办公时代,手机处理微软文字文档已成为刚需。本文将深入解析十二款主流手机文字处理软件,涵盖微软官方办公套件、金山办公系列以及功能独特的第三方工具。通过对比分析各软件在功能完整性、云端协作、界面设计及特色功能的实际表现,并结合具体应用场景案例,为不同需求的用户提供精准选型建议,帮助您在移动端高效完成文档编辑工作。
2025-11-06 02:41:39
124人看过
本文深度解析微软文字处理软件中多余制表符的十二种成因及解决方案,涵盖显示设置异常、格式标记误操作、样式模板错误等核心问题。通过实际案例演示官方推荐的清除技巧,包括显示隐藏字符、调整段落设置、使用查找替换功能等专业操作方法,帮助用户彻底解决文档排版异常问题。
2025-11-06 02:41:35
218人看过
立即窗口是集成在Visual Basic编辑器中的强大调试工具,它允许用户直接执行VBA代码片段并实时查看结果。通过立即窗口,用户可以快速测试函数、检查变量值、调试代码逻辑,极大提升了VBA开发效率。本文将详细解析立即窗口的功能特性、使用技巧及实际应用场景。
2025-11-06 02:33:25
127人看过
热门推荐
资讯中心:
.webp)
.webp)

.webp)

.webp)